Application

Endothelin-2 (Vasoactive Intestinal Constrictor), mouse, a vaso-constricting peptide, is used in studies of the maintenance, protection and hyper-pigmentation of the epidermis.

We previously found that endothelin-2/vasoactive intestinal contractor (ET-2/VIC) greatly increased in mouse epidermis after birth.
